Serbia's new parliament today voted in a conservative-led minority government backed by the Socialists of jailed ex-leader Slobodan Milosevic, a combination that has sparked concern in Western capitals.

The 250-seat assembly approved the 18-member cabinet of Prime Minister Vojislav Kostunica, a self-styled moderate nationalist who helped topple Milosevic in 2000, by 130 votes to 113.
